Key features to include in an empty bill format for accounting and tax

Design templates with accounting workflows in mind: include fields for line-item details, tax treatment, identifiers for accounting systems, and signature or approval placeholders for audit readiness.

Line items

Structured line-item fields that capture quantity, unit price, description, SKU or service codes, and tax applicability to match accounting ledger entries and support accurate revenue and expense classification.

Tax summary

A dedicated tax calculation section showing taxable subtotal, tax rates by jurisdiction, and total tax collected, designed to feed tax reporting and simplify state and federal filings.

Accounting codes

Fields to map each line item to a general ledger account, department, or project code to support automated posting and reduce manual reconciliation work for accountants.

Payment terms

Clear payment due date, accepted payment methods, early payment discounts, and late fee rules to align billing with company cash flow policies and receivable management.

Approval block

Designated signer or approver fields with date stamps and role labels to document internal controls and authorization for tax-deductible expenses or revenue recognition.

Metadata

Hidden or visible metadata fields for vendor ID, internal reference, and system timestamps that help with automated imports and audit trail completeness.

Best practices for secure, accurate empty bill formats

Adopt consistent templates, validation, and control measures so that empty bill format documents remain reliable sources for accounting entries and tax filings.

Standardize mandatory tax fields across templates
Require vendor tax identifiers, taxable subtotals, tax jurisdictions, and tax rate fields so every invoice supports tax calculations and reduces the need for manual corrections during filing and audit preparation.
Use role-based approvals and versioning controls
Implement an approval chain with role separation, and lock templates after tax close to prevent unauthorized edits that could compromise financial statements or tax reports.
Validate data formats before posting
Enforce numeric and date formats, required field checks, and referential integrity for account codes to reduce posting errors and improve integration reliability with accounting systems.
Maintain clear retention and archival policies
Define and apply document retention schedules consistent with tax laws, preserve audit logs, and ensure encrypted offsite backups for long-term access during audits.
